Today is the 44th anniversary of Stevie Wonder’s Songs in the Key of Life. “I Wish,” “Isn’t She Lovely,” “Sir Duke,” “Another Star,” “As” were all released as singles. But, the biggest wow for me was when I realized that Coolio’s “Gangsta’s Paradise” is a direct sample from this tune, which in this video he doesn’t sing but plays a mean blues harp. Enjoy!
